Output 39e952c5659ce0a662989973d33f1064adc09340b9ed5399b7470fdb58075303:0

value
2060213605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b31523c40595f7a6637cc0d96bfa2c932e531b2f OP_EQUALVERIFY OP_CHECKSIG
address
DMTzpQfhUMXJCo8Yg1oVxkRCdramFAqyvf
transaction
39e952c5659ce0a662989973d33f1064adc09340b9ed5399b7470fdb58075303